An insubstantial meal for a person, but he always shared with his dog.
With the pound in his plastic container, he got a free coffee, from Costa, and a pack of out-of-date chicken to eat with his dog Mitch.
Many looked at him with disgust in their eyes.
He would watch them walk out of the restaurant with full bellies, not understanding his life. An observer, most would ignore him. He wasn’t important enough to speak to, and it was their understanding he would keep quiet.
‘Would you like this soup, cake, and chicken for your dog?’
She knelt down in front of him, was the first person to show him kindness.
‘Thank you Miss.’
Taking what was offered, it was a handsome meal. He smiled as she sat down beside him, stroking Mitch.
‘I’m sorry it isn’t more,’ she said.
‘It’s more than enough Miss, but you don’t have to stay.’
‘What is a meal without the company of someone to share it with,’ she said, eating from her own sandwich.
‘True Miss.’
‘My name is Sarah, what’s yours?’
He hadn’t spoken his name, since he walked out of his home at the age of eighteen.
